|
|
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
всем добрый день есть проблема, мне нужны срочно библиотеки на Си, которые умеют 1. изменять раскладку клавы, для это можно использовать библиотеку user32.dll 2. считывание информации из внешнего устройста - сканера штрих-кодов 3. считываение информации из COM2 порта с чего мне надо начать? Си я знаю совсем немного, но готов изучать, посоветуйте достойную лит-ру если кто-то может решить эти проблемы за деньги, милости просим 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 13:02 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
Нооовенькийвсем добрый день есть проблема, мне нужны срочно библиотеки на Си, которые умеют 1. изменять раскладку клавы, для это можно использовать библиотеку user32.dll 2. считывание информации из внешнего устройста - сканера штрих-кодов 3. считываение информации из COM2 порта с чего мне надо начать? Си я знаю совсем немного, но готов изучать, посоветуйте достойную лит-ру если кто-то может решить эти проблемы за деньги, милости просим Начать надо с выбора системы для программирования (я имею в виду OCь: Винды, ДОС, *nix или может быть real-time типа QNX). После этого надо зарываться в умные книжки по теме, искать спецификацию протокола (какие биты в пакете, считанном из COM-порта, что обозначают и какова вообще длина пакета и т.д.), по которому общаются сканер и комп, проштудировать MSDN / man по данному вопросу и только после этого лезть в форум за помощью... Ибо решение, на халяву полученное на форуме, а не выстраданное "собственной кровью" дает очень мало для развития... По поводу раскладки клавиатуры: В поиск по форуму. Где-то был исходник для отработки попытки смены кодировки рус->лат и наоборот...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 14:00 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
Станислав C. Нооовенькийвсем добрый день есть проблема, мне нужны срочно библиотеки на Си, которые умеют 1. изменять раскладку клавы, для это можно использовать библиотеку user32.dll 2. считывание информации из внешнего устройста - сканера штрих-кодов 3. считываение информации из COM2 порта с чего мне надо начать? Си я знаю совсем немного, но готов изучать, посоветуйте достойную лит-ру если кто-то может решить эти проблемы за деньги, милости просим Начать надо с выбора системы для программирования (я имею в виду OCь: Винды, ДОС, *nix или может быть real-time типа QNX). После этого надо зарываться в умные книжки по теме, искать спецификацию протокола (какие биты в пакете, считанном из COM-порта, что обозначают и какова вообще длина пакета и т.д.), по которому общаются сканер и комп, проштудировать MSDN / man по данному вопросу и только после этого лезть в форум за помощью... Ибо решение, на халяву полученное на форуме, а не выстраданное "собственной кровью" дает очень мало для развития... По поводу раскладки клавиатуры: В поиск по форуму. Где-то был исходник для отработки попытки смены кодировки рус->лат и наоборот...Не верь ему :) Не надо ни в какие книги зарываться. Я в них давно разочаровался, особенно если в переводе. Иностранных авторов читать - там процентов 90 философии остальное вроде бы и по делу, но приходится сначала на язык автора переводить, а потом обратно. Лучше всего читать документацию по конкретному продукту в оригинале. Если под виндой VC, то MSDN. --------------------------------------------------------------------------- Если за деньги, то конкретнее ТЗ и цена.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 14:48 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
_Балтика Если за деньги, то конкретнее ТЗ и цена. конкретнее - цена 500 у.е. торг уместен ТЗ - следующее есть формы, созданные в forms developer под оракл, работает все через сервер приложений, т.е. прямо к клиенту обратиться и получить какие-то сведения о подключенных устройствах (равно как и смену раскладки клавы) можно только с помощью спец.утилит, которые используют только си-шные библиотеки, на остальных рубятся сразу. сам сервер приложений работает под линухом у клиентов win2000pro 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 15:46 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
Нооовенький _Балтика Если за деньги, то конкретнее ТЗ и цена. конкретнее - цена 500 у.е. торг уместен ТЗ - следующее есть формы, созданные в forms developer под оракл, работает все через сервер приложений, т.е. прямо к клиенту обратиться и получить какие-то сведения о подключенных устройствах (равно как и смену раскладки клавы) можно только с помощью спец.утилит, которые используют только си-шные библиотеки, на остальных рубятся сразу. сам сервер приложений работает под линухом у клиентов win2000proИзвини, не понял. С таким ТЗ я - пас. Что конкретно нужно писать для клинтской и серверной части? А лучше бы тебе все это дело перенести в "Работу" 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 16:18 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
_Балтика Нооовенький _Балтика Если за деньги, то конкретнее ТЗ и цена. конкретнее - цена 500 у.е. торг уместен ТЗ - следующее есть формы, созданные в forms developer под оракл, работает все через сервер приложений, т.е. прямо к клиенту обратиться и получить какие-то сведения о подключенных устройствах (равно как и смену раскладки клавы) можно только с помощью спец.утилит, которые используют только си-шные библиотеки, на остальных рубятся сразу. сам сервер приложений работает под линухом у клиентов win2000proИзвини, не понял. С таким ТЗ я - пас. Что конкретно нужно писать для клинтской и серверной части? А лучше бы тебе все это дело перенести в "Работу" для серверной ничего не надо для клиентской 1.библиотеку, которая выдает информацию о штрихкоде, который прочитал сканер 2. библиотеку, которая переключает раскладку клавы 3. библиотеку, которая возвращает переменные с Com2 порта в работу уже написал 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 16:44 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
Нооовенький для клиентской 1.библиотеку, которая выдает информацию о штрихкоде, прочитал сканер 2. библиотеку, которая переключает раскладку клавы 3. библиотеку, которая возвращает переменные с Com2 порта 1. Драйвер или АПИ какое-нибудь к ридеру есть? 2. Это две строчки. 3. Написл я когда-то COM-объект такой, но почему COM2 именно? :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 17:06 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
Нооовенький...для клиентской 1.библиотеку, которая выдает информацию о штрихкоде, который прочитал сканер 2. библиотеку, которая переключает раскладку клавы 3. библиотеку, которая возвращает переменные с Com2 порта... у Вас точно винда ? Если компьютерный POS - то вроде как запрещено было юзать многозадачную ось ? Под досом всё это есть. И именно для сертифицированных касс 1) ABS 2) IPC POS 3) IPC POS GRS удачи Вам (круглый)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.02.2006, 17:46 |
|
||
|
с чего начинается Си
|
|||
|---|---|---|---|
|
#18+
kolobok0 Нооовенький...для клиентской 1.библиотеку, которая выдает информацию о штрихкоде, который прочитал сканер 2. библиотеку, которая переключает раскладку клавы 3. библиотеку, которая возвращает переменные с Com2 порта... у Вас точно винда ? Если компьютерный POS - то вроде как запрещено было юзать многозадачную ось ? Под досом всё это есть. И именно для сертифицированных касс 1) ABS 2) IPC POS 3) IPC POS GRS удачи Вам (круглый) если честно, то ничего не понял? при чем тут кассы?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.02.2006, 12:17 |
|
||
|
|

start [/forum/topic.php?fid=57&msg=33531108&tid=2031967]: |
0ms |
get settings: |
9ms |
get forum list: |
14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
157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
48ms |
get tp. blocked users: |
1ms |
| others: | 236ms |
| total: | 482ms |

| 0 / 0 |
